Guide to Fix Bluetooth Issues on iPhone 8 and iPhone X
1. Restart Your iPhone
Let's initiate the process of restarting your iPhone 8 or iPhone X. This straightforward method helps you resolve common iOS device issues such as software conflicts or connectivity problems like Wi-Fi and Bluetooth.
Step 1 : Simply press and hold the Power button on your iPhone for 3 to 5 seconds. When the screen displays the Swipe to Power Off icon, swipe the icon as shown below.
Step 2 : After that, the system will automatically power off the device. Once the iPhone 8, iPhone X is completely off, continue holding the Power button to restart your device.
Step 3 : We will check if the Bluetooth issue on iPhone 8 and iPhone X has been completely resolved.
3. Reset AirPlay Settings
One of the simple next steps to troubleshoot Bluetooth issues on iPhone 8 and iPhone X is to reset the AirPlay mode on your iOS device. Especially for those who can't connect their iPhone to other iPhones or computers.
Step 1 : Swipe the screen upward from the bottom, and here we'll long-press on the Connect icons as shown below.
Step 2 : To reset AirPlay and fix Bluetooth issues on iPhone 8, iPhone X, select the AirPlay icon and set the mode to Everyone.
Step 3 : After that, you will retry connecting the iPhone 8, iPhone X to see if the previous issue has been successfully resolved.
4. Delete Old, Faulty Connections
If you're still struggling with Bluetooth issues on iPhone 8 and iPhone X, even after previous connections, consider deleting old, faulty connections and reconnecting. Follow these steps:
Step 1 : Access the Settings app, then choose Bluetooth connections from this settings screen.
Step 2 : Then, we'll select the Bluetooth connection that's encountering issues on iPhone 8, iPhone X, and press the 'i' icon. Afterward, select Forget Connect.
Step 3 : Reconnect Bluetooth with this device once again.

5. Reset Network Settings on iPhone
Next up in our quest to fix Bluetooth issues on iPhone 8 and iPhone X is opting for resetting network settings on the iPhone. Here's how to do it:
Step 1 : Access the Settings app from the home screen, then select the General settings option. Next, choose the Reset category.
Step 2 : To fix Bluetooth issues on iPhone 8 and iPhone X, select the Reset Network Settings feature, then confirm the Reset Network Settings action.
This process will restart your device once more, and after a successful restart, we have resolved the Bluetooth issue on your iPhone.
